Berhampur University Recruitment 2026 – Eligibility Criteria
Candidates must fulfil all eligibility conditions as on the closing date of online application submission (10-06-2026, Midnight). The educational qualification must be from a recognised University established under a Central Act, Provincial Act, State Act, or an Institution recognised by the UGC. Qualifications and selections are as per the UGC Regulations Notification No. F.1-2/2017(EC/PS), 18th July 2018, and as amended from time to time. Candidates above 60 years are not eligible to apply.
Essential Qualifications for Professor (Pay Level-14 as per 7th CPC)
Eligibility (A or B):
- An eminent scholar having a Ph.D. degree in the concerned/allied/relevant discipline and published work of high quality, actively engaged in research with evidence of published work with a minimum of 10 research publications in peer-reviewed or UGC-listed journals and a total research score of 120 as per the criteria given in Appendix II, Table 2 of UGC Regulation No. F.1-2/2017(EC/PS), 18th July 2018.
- A minimum of ten years of teaching experience in a university/college as Assistant Professor/Associate Professor/Professor, and/or research experience at an equivalent level at the University/National Level Institutions, with evidence of having successfully guided doctoral candidates.
- An outstanding professional, having a Ph.D. degree in the relevant/allied/applied disciplines, from any academic institution (not included in A above) / industry, who has made a significant contribution to the knowledge in the concerned/allied/relevant discipline, supported by documentary evidence, provided he/she has ten years’ experience.
Essential Qualifications for Associate Professor (Pay Level-13A as per 7th CPC)
- A good academic record, with a Ph.D. Degree in the concerned/allied/relevant disciplines.
- A Master’s Degree with 55% marks (or an equivalent grade in a point scale wherever a grading system is followed) in a concerned/relevant/allied subject from an Indian University or an equivalent degree from a foreign University.
- For SC/ST/Non-Creamy layer OBC/Differently abled candidates, the requirement at the master’s level is 50%. Relaxation of 5% in marks is also applicable to Ph.D. degree holders who completed a master’s degree before 19 September 1991.
- A minimum of eight years of experience in teaching and/or research in an academic/research position equivalent to that of Assistant Professor in a University, College, or Accredited Research Institution/industry with a minimum of seven publications in peer-reviewed or UGC-listed journals and a total research score of Seventy-five (75) as per the criteria given in Appendix II, Table 2 of UGC Regulation No. F.1-2/2017(EC/PS), 18th July 2018.
Essential Qualifications for Assistant Professor (Pay Level-10 as per 7th CPC)
Eligibility (A or B):
- A Master’s Degree with 55% marks (or an equivalent grade in a point scale wherever a grading system is followed) in a concerned/relevant/allied subject from an Indian University or an equivalent degree from a foreign University.
- For SC/ST/Non-Creamy layer OBC/Differently abled candidates, the requirement at the master’s level is 50%. Relaxation of 5% in marks is also applicable to Ph.D. degree holders who completed a master’s degree before 19 September 1991.
- Must have cleared the National Eligibility Test (NET) conducted by the UGC or the CSIR or a similar test accredited by the UGC, like SLET/SET.
- Candidates who are or have been awarded a Ph.D. Degree in accordance with the University Grants Commission (Minimum Standards and Procedure for Award of M.Phil./Ph.D. Degree) Regulations, 2009 or 2016, and their amendments are exempted from NET/SLET/SET.
- As per UGC Notification dated 30th June 2023: “NET/SET/SLET shall be the minimum criteria for the direct recruitment to the post of Assistant Professor for all Higher Education Institutions”.
- The Ph.D. degree has been obtained from a foreign university/institution with a ranking among the top 500 in the World University Ranking (at any time) by any one of the following: (i) Quacquarelli Symonds (QS) (ii) the Times Higher Education (THE) or (iii) the Academic Ranking of World Universities (ARWU) of the Shanghai Jiao Tong University (Shanghai).

Berhampur University Recruitment 2026 – Selection Process
The selection process for Berhampur University Recruitment 2026 consists of Screening/Scrutiny of applications, followed by an interview. The Screening/Scrutiny and subsequent selection will be as per the UGC Notification 18th July 2018 and supported by the Act and Statute of the University. The selection committee composition will be as per the UGC Notification dated 18th July 2018.
Selection Process Steps:
- Application Screening/Scrutiny: Applications received by the due date will be screened/scrutinized as per UGC norms.
- Shortlisting:
- For a single post: A maximum of 15 candidates will be called for an interview.
- For multiple posts: Candidates will be called in the ratio of 1:10 as per the scores secured during scrutiny.
- Shortlisting as per UGC Notification 18th July 2018 (Table 3A of Appendix-II for Assistant Professor and Table 2 of Appendix-II for Associate Professor and Professor).
- Display of List: List of eligible and ineligible candidates will be displayed on the website.
- Interview: Shortlisted candidates will be called for an interview with a mandatory PPT presentation.
Interview Evaluation Criteria:
The candidate will be judged holistically:
- Cognitive Domain: Knowledge in the subject’s domain.
- Psychomotor Domain: Experience and skill.
- Affective Domain: Received and response to the question, confidence, etc.
- Vision & Strength: To empower the students to develop Odisha and Vikashit Bharat, including Aatmanirbhar Bharat.
Mandatory PPT Presentation for Interview (9 Slides Only):
| Slide No. | Content Required |
|---|---|
| Slide 1 | Brief biodata |
| Slide 2 | Subject domain strength (core strength and name of subjects/specialisation) |
| Slide 3 | Practical skill/experience that makes you unique |
| Slide 4 | How will you empower students to develop Odisha, Vikashit Bharat, including Aatmanirbhar Bharat |
| Slide 5 | How you will use AI in pedagogy and how the discipline will contribute to the AI ecosystem |
| Slide 6 | Research projects that can be submitted and funding agency names |
| Slide 7 | Consultancy for outreach activities and link to SDGs |
| Slide 8 | Possible national and international collaborations (type, organisation name, and your link) |
| Slide 9 | How can you contribute to the overall development of the University/Department |
PPT Format Requirements:
- Font size: Arial Black, 24.
- No introduction and thank you slide.
- Candidates will be stopped after the 9th slide.
- No extra slide(s) will be allowed.
Documents Required at Interview:
Candidates must bring original documents of all certificates/Publications/Grade Cards, etc., submitted along with the application form.
How to Apply for Berhampur University Recruitment 2026
Applications must be submitted online only through the HIMS Portal (https://hims.odisha.gov.in/), which will be available from 07.05.2026 onwards. No other mode of application will be accepted. The online portal is active from 07-05-2026 to 10-06-2026 (Midnight). In addition to online submission, a hard copy of the downloaded submitted application, along with all relevant documents, must be sent via Speed Post to reach the Registrar on or before 20.06.2026.
Steps to Apply Online:
- Click the official apply link below to visit the HIMS Portal at https://hims.odisha.gov.in/ and submit your application, ensuring the hard copy is mailed by Speed Post to reach on or before 20.06.2026.
Important Points for Application:
- Candidates applying for more than one post must apply separately for each post and pay the application fee for each post.
- The online application can be filled out in multiple sessions.
- Persons employed in the Government/Public Sector Enterprise/Autonomous bodies should forward a copy through a proper channel or furnish a No Objection Certificate (NOC).
- The envelope containing the hard copy must be superscribed “APPLICATION FOR THE POST OF ” along with the advertisement No and Date.
- Courier, ordinary post, and hand delivery are not accepted for hard copy submission.
- No hard copy will be considered if the applicant fails to submit the online application.
- Hard copies of applications from applicants who have applied online before the closing date will be accepted if it reaches by 20.06.2026.
